OPPO will soon be releasing its two smartphones from R series. The device is making rounds on TENNA website which means the official announcement is not far off. The two handsets are named R8205 and R8200.
Both smartphone are identical with only one difference. Design-wise both smartphones come in shiny back-plate in blue or white with curved edges, similar to the design of OPPO R1. Both have 5-inch capacitive TFT display with a resolution of 1280 x 720 pixels. Both are powered by an octa-core Cortex A7 CPU, clocked at 1.5GHz and have 16GB of onboard storage and 2GB of RAM.
Physical dimensions are 140.6×70.1×6.85 mm and weigh 130 gram. Each of the mobile has dual camera, 13MP rear camera and 5MP front snapper. The list of features also comes with lucrative connectivity options: 4G, 3G, GPRS/ EDGE,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, Micro-USB, and Bluetooth v4.0, and a few standard sensors are G-Sensor, Gravity sensor, Proximity sensor, Light sensor.
The only major difference is that the R8205 will support CDMA networks. There is currently no accurate information about pricing of two siblings and their launch date.
